Description:
This course studies incentive structures relating to the allocation of resources, both through the state and through markets. This includes not only the incentives for participants in those institutions, but also the incentives which they produce for those interacting with those institutions. In the case of the state, for example, this ranges from the behavior of candidates and office holders in creating policy to the behavior which policies induce in individuals subject to them.
